- Posts: 19
- Thank you received: 0
Welcome to the LimeSurvey Community Forum
Ask the community, share ideas, and connect with other LimeSurvey users!
Définir les valeurs par défaut sur des curseurs à partir d'une autre question
- RimRejeb
- Topic Author
- Offline
- New Member
Less
More
2 years 10 months ago - 2 years 10 months ago #215782
by RimRejeb
Définir les valeurs par défaut sur des curseurs à partir d'une autre question was created by RimRejeb
Bonjour,
Je suis entrain de construire un "slider task" où j'ai des participants qui doivent glisser 50 curseurs [0; 0.2] pour gagner 10€.
Je souhaite définir des valeurs initiales par défaut des positions des curseurs pour chaque participant dépendamment d'une réponse à une question précédente. Dans cette question précédente, le participant indique un montant entre 0€ et 10€ (par incrément de 0.2€).
Est-ce que c'est possible sur Limesurvey d'avoir des options par défauts personnalisées sur les questions avec curseurs en partageant la valeur de cette question précédente sur les curseurs? (J'utilise la Version 3.24.3+201027)
Pour mieux illustrer ce que j'aimerais faire voici un exemple:
Supposons qu'un participant X qui a répondu à une question Q1 le montant 1€.
Dans une question Q2, on présente le "slider task" avec les 50 curseurs dont 5 sont déjà positionnés sur 0.2 faisant référence au 1€ indiqué par le participant dans Q1.
Est-ce que cette manipulation est possible?
Merci d'avance pour tout aide.
Je suis entrain de construire un "slider task" où j'ai des participants qui doivent glisser 50 curseurs [0; 0.2] pour gagner 10€.
Je souhaite définir des valeurs initiales par défaut des positions des curseurs pour chaque participant dépendamment d'une réponse à une question précédente. Dans cette question précédente, le participant indique un montant entre 0€ et 10€ (par incrément de 0.2€).
Est-ce que c'est possible sur Limesurvey d'avoir des options par défauts personnalisées sur les questions avec curseurs en partageant la valeur de cette question précédente sur les curseurs? (J'utilise la Version 3.24.3+201027)
Pour mieux illustrer ce que j'aimerais faire voici un exemple:
Supposons qu'un participant X qui a répondu à une question Q1 le montant 1€.
Dans une question Q2, on présente le "slider task" avec les 50 curseurs dont 5 sont déjà positionnés sur 0.2 faisant référence au 1€ indiqué par le participant dans Q1.
Est-ce que cette manipulation est possible?
Merci d'avance pour tout aide.
Last edit: 2 years 10 months ago by RimRejeb.
The topic has been locked.
- DenisChenu
- Offline
- LimeSurvey Community Team
Less
More
- Posts: 13935
- Thank you received: 2551
2 years 10 months ago #215784
by DenisChenu
Assistance on LimeSurvey forum and LimeSurvey core development are on my free time.
I'm not a LimeSurvey GmbH member, professional service on demand , plugin development .
I don't answer to private message.
Replied by DenisChenu on topic Définir les valeurs par défaut sur des curseurs à partir d'une autre question
Assistance on LimeSurvey forum and LimeSurvey core development are on my free time.
I'm not a LimeSurvey GmbH member, professional service on demand , plugin development .
I don't answer to private message.
The topic has been locked.
- RimRejeb
- Topic Author
- Offline
- New Member
Less
More
- Posts: 19
- Thank you received: 0
2 years 10 months ago #215789
by RimRejeb
Replied by RimRejeb on topic Définir les valeurs par défaut sur des curseurs à partir d'une autre question
Merci Denis pour votre réponse.
J'ai déjà regardé le manuel où on propose de définir les valeur par défaut en passant par le bouton "Edit default options".
Ce n'est pas exactement ce que je cherchais, ou peut-être je n'ai pas bien compris votre réponse.
De ce que j'ai vu, on peut mettre des conditions individuelles sur chaque curseur.
En restant sur l'illustration présentée dans ma question originale, je peux mettre pour le 1er, 2ème...5ème curseurs qu'on commence avec 0.2€, et pour les autres commencer à 0€.
Mais cela ne répond pas à ma question. Si un autre participant Y répond dans une question Q1, 5€. Comment je pourrais pour Q2 où j'ai le slider task, avoir automatiquement en fonction de cette réponse 25 curseurs prépositionnés sur 0.2 (25 = 5€/ 0.2)?
Merci!
J'ai déjà regardé le manuel où on propose de définir les valeur par défaut en passant par le bouton "Edit default options".
Ce n'est pas exactement ce que je cherchais, ou peut-être je n'ai pas bien compris votre réponse.
De ce que j'ai vu, on peut mettre des conditions individuelles sur chaque curseur.
En restant sur l'illustration présentée dans ma question originale, je peux mettre pour le 1er, 2ème...5ème curseurs qu'on commence avec 0.2€, et pour les autres commencer à 0€.
Mais cela ne répond pas à ma question. Si un autre participant Y répond dans une question Q1, 5€. Comment je pourrais pour Q2 où j'ai le slider task, avoir automatiquement en fonction de cette réponse 25 curseurs prépositionnés sur 0.2 (25 = 5€/ 0.2)?
Merci!
The topic has been locked.
- DenisChenu
- Offline
- LimeSurvey Community Team
Less
More
- Posts: 13935
- Thank you received: 2551
2 years 10 months ago #215816
by DenisChenu
Assistance on LimeSurvey forum and LimeSurvey core development are on my free time.
I'm not a LimeSurvey GmbH member, professional service on demand , plugin development .
I don't answer to private message.
Replied by DenisChenu on topic Définir les valeurs par défaut sur des curseurs à partir d'une autre question
Tu peux utiliser le gestionnaire d'expression (avec les questions des pages précédentes) sur les valeur par défaut.
Donc, par exemple :
{if(Q1.NAOK > 0.2,0.2)}
{if(Q1.NAOK > 0.4,0.2)}
{if(Q1.NAOK > 0.6,0.2)}
{if(Q1.NAOK > 0.8,0.2)}
{if(Q1.NAOK > 1,0.2)}
{if(Q1.NAOK > 1.2,0.2)}
etc …
(si j'ai bien compris)
C'est une valeur par défaut : donc que avec des questions des pages précédentes (sinon, c'est une valeur dynamique).
Donc, par exemple :
{if(Q1.NAOK > 0.2,0.2)}
{if(Q1.NAOK > 0.4,0.2)}
{if(Q1.NAOK > 0.6,0.2)}
{if(Q1.NAOK > 0.8,0.2)}
{if(Q1.NAOK > 1,0.2)}
{if(Q1.NAOK > 1.2,0.2)}
etc …
(si j'ai bien compris)
C'est une valeur par défaut : donc que avec des questions des pages précédentes (sinon, c'est une valeur dynamique).
Assistance on LimeSurvey forum and LimeSurvey core development are on my free time.
I'm not a LimeSurvey GmbH member, professional service on demand , plugin development .
I don't answer to private message.
The following user(s) said Thank You: RimRejeb
The topic has been locked.
- RimRejeb
- Topic Author
- Offline
- New Member
Less
More
- Posts: 19
- Thank you received: 0
2 years 10 months ago #215825
by RimRejeb
Replied by RimRejeb on topic Définir les valeurs par défaut sur des curseurs à partir d'une autre question
Je viens de faire le test et c'est exactement ça ce que je cherchais!
Merci beaucoup Denis t'es un héro
Merci beaucoup Denis t'es un héro
The topic has been locked.
Moderators: Nickko